Conservation Alliance
The Conservation Alliance is a non-profit organization of outdoor businesses that give back to the outdoors by supporting grassroots citizen-action groups in their efforts to protect wild and natural areas.
One hundred percent of its member companies' dues go directly to diverse, local community groups across the nation - groups like Southern Utah Wilderness Alliance, Alliance for the Wild Rockies, The Greater Yellowstone Coalition, the South Yuba River Citizens' League, RESTORE: The North Woods and the Sinkyone Wilderness Council (a Native American-owned/operated wilderness park). For these groups, who seek to protect the last great wild lands and waterways from resource extraction and commercial development, the Alliance's grants are substantial in size and have often made the difference between success and defeat.
Since its inception in 1989, The Conservation Alliance has contributed more than $5 million to grassroots environmental groups across the nation that have funded or saved over 34 million acres of wild lands and prevented or removed 14 dams.
Ultimately, the Alliance believes that more than any other group, the outdoor industry should be giving back to the landscapes its customers enjoy.
